Tverrfjellet
Tverrfjellet is a hill in Ørsta, Møre og Romsdal, Western Norway and has an elevation of 280 metres. Tverrfjellet is situated nearby to the hamlet Ullaland, as well as near Hjartå.| Tap on a place to explore it |
